Handover Note — Product-Line Retirement

Hi all — as I hand the reins to Dara, a quick recap on winding down the Spindrift line. Last manufacturing run finishes in March; support commitments carry through year end. Stock at the Kellsmoor depot gets discounted via outlet partners, and the tooling goes to Halvane Fabrication. Customers on maintenance contracts get migration offers to Driftwood Pro. Dara owns comms from here. The bigger picture driving this sits just below.

internal memo for bawef-kajef: Novokix Logistics is in early talks to buy Briaelax Freight for about $167.0 million. The Zorius launch date is April 3, and nothing goes to the press before then. Legal wants the Frairax Holdings term sheet redrafted before August 10.

Hey — handing off the telemetry compression branch for Quillbox. Main change: batched payloads now go through delta encoding before zstd, which cut average size about 40%. Watch the edge case where a batch has one event — the encoder used to choke there, tests cover it now. Marisol reviewed the schema half already. Benchmarks and design notes are on the page below.

runbook for baguf-bawip: https://jira.qorvelsys.internal/pages/pages/pages/browse/1853

**Ticket: Brickline component library publishes mismatched versions**

The Brickline UI kit tagged 4.2.0 in the registry, but the bundled manifest still reports 4.1.3, so downstream apps at Corvane fail their integrity check. The fix bumps the manifest during the publish step rather than at tag time. Please review the pipeline change carefully; to verify, compare the manifest against the token recorded below.

session token of yahof-bajeg = htk9_0d43d44ed